What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a doctor focusing on mental health who provides services outside the National Health Service (NHS). These specialists provide consultations, assessments, and treatments for different mental health conditions, consisting of anxiety, anxiety, bipolar illness, and schizophrenia.

Private psychiatric services can differ commonly in cost, influenced by the practitioner's experience, area, and the complexity of care required. Below is a basic breakdown:
ServiceApproximated CostPreliminary Assessment₤ 200 - ₤ 500Follow-Up Consultation₤ 100 - ₤ 300Psychiatric Report₤ 300 - ₤ 700Mental Testing₤ 300 - ₤ 800
Many private psychiatrists provide minimized rates for block reservations or plan deals, and some might even offer payment strategies. It is important to go over charges clearly upfront to avoid any misconceptions.

2. How do I understand if I require to see a psychiatrist?
If an individual is experiencing consistent sensations of sadness, stress and anxiety, or modifications in habits that affect daily performance, it might be beneficial to talk with a psychiatrist.
3. What should I anticipate throughout my very first appointment?
Throughout the preliminary visit, the psychiatrist will generally perform a comprehensive assessment, including a conversation of your case history, existing problems, and treatment objectives.
4. Can I switch psychiatrists if I'm not pleased?
Yes, clients are entitled to look for out another psychiatrist if they feel their requirements are not being satisfied. It is vital to feel comfy and supported in the healing relationship.
5. For how long does treatment normally last?
The period of treatment differs considerably depending on the person's requirements, the intensity of the condition, and the treatment techniques employed. Some might need a couple of sessions, while others might require continuous care over numerous months or years.
